The story of “Lolita” from St. Petersburg in the 2000s will appeal to fans of books “My Dark Vanessa,” “The Garden of First Love,” and “Season of Poisoned Fruits.”

The main heroine, Ksusha, lives in a yellow-eyed apartment building on the outskirts of the city with her mother, who sometimes slips into alcohol dependence. Ksusha tries to find her place in school and make friends, but it doesn’t work out.

In her life appears Yura, an older man who is already married. He pulls Ksusha into a complicated relationship full of fears and addictions. Will real love arise between them, or will these feelings be only an attempt to fill the emptiness left after her father?

This story highlights the contradiction between childhood and sexuality, showing how a girl gradually becomes a woman. The book describes unconventional growing up in the 2000s, with a subtle sense of horror and tenderness.
